카테고리 없음

InstallShield Tutorial, Testing Project

Soul-Learner 2013. 4. 11. 20:27

인스톨쉴드에서 프로그램 설치파일을 생성하는 단계는 대략 3단계로 이루어진다.

1. 프로젝트 생성 및 테스트

2. 세부적인 설정

3. 배포용 설치파일 생성


아래의 절차는 제 1단계 작업으로 프로젝트 생성 및 테스트용 setup.exe 파일을 생성하고 인스톨쉴드 안에서 setup.exe 파일을 실행하여 로컬 시스템에 설치해보고 다시 삭제하는 전체의 내용을 순서대로 캡쳐한 것이다


Creating, Building, Testing Project







아래의 화면에서 입력한 company name, application name은 시작메뉴에 나타나며, 제어판의 프로그램 추가/삭제에서도 보여지는 이름으로 사용되고 TARGETDIR 시스템변수의 기본값으로 할당된다





















동적링크가 아닌 정적링크로 설정해야만 대상 시스템에 그대로 복사되므로 라이브러리를 찾지못하여 오류가 발생하는 경우를 피할 수 있다
















지금까지 설정했던 프로젝트를 빌드하여 setup.exe를 생성하는 단계이다. 이 때 생성되는 setup.exe는 최종적으로 생성되는 설치파일이 아니라 현재의 프로젝트를 테스트할 목적으로 생성되는 것으로써 인스톨쉴드 안에서 setup.exe 파일의 실행여부를 테스트하기 위한 것이다.


위의 과정을 마치면 프로젝트가 저장되는 폴더에 setup.exe 파일이 생성된 것을 확인할 수 있다

C:\InstallShield 2010 Projects\Tutorial Project\Media\SINGLE_EXE_IMAGE\Disk Images\Disk1\setup.exe


테스트용 setup.exe 파일이 위의 경로에 생성되었으므로 실행 테스트를 하여 문제없이 실행된다면 현재의 프로젝트가 성공한 것이다.


지금까지 설정했던 프로젝트가 빌드된 테스트용 setup.exe를 실행하면 다음과 같이 정상적으로 설치파일이 실행되는 것을 확인할 수 있다.




Uninstalling the Program

인스톨쉴드 안에서 테스트 목적으로 설치했던 프로그램은 인스톨쉴드 안에서 또한 삭제할 수 있다. 삭제할 때의 모든 절차는 실제 이용자가 프로그램을 삭제할 때의 모양과 동일하게 나타난다


지금까지의 절차는 기본 프로젝트를 생성한 것에 지나지 않으며 아직 실제 이용자가 사용할 수 있는 설치파일을 생성한 것은 아니다. 그러므로  설정 사항들을 좀더 세밀하게 설정할 수 있는 Installation Designer 탭을 선택하여 다음 절차를 진행해야 한다.